“Book Review: Zest for Success: The Proven Path to Successful Entrepreneurship by Victoria Berry
Zest for Success by Victoria Berry is an insightful and motivational guide for aspiring entrepreneurs looking to launch and grow successful businesses. Berry draws on her extensive experience in the business world to provide practical advice, strategies, and inspiration for those embarking on their entrepreneurial journey. The book’s central message is that success in business requires not only practical skills but also the right mindset, passion, and determination.
Themes
The Entrepreneurial Mindset: One of the key themes of Zest for Success is the importance of cultivating the right mindset for entrepreneurship. Berry emphasizes the need for resilience, optimism, and adaptability in the face of challenges. She encourages readers to view obstacles as opportunities for growth and stresses that success often comes from perseverance and a willingness to learn from failure.
Passion and Purpose-Driven Business: Berry makes a strong case for building a business around something you are passionate about. She argues that passion is a key driver of success because it fuels motivation and helps entrepreneurs stay focused and committed during tough times. By aligning your business with your personal values and interests, you are more likely to create a product or service that resonates with customers and stands out in the market.
Practical Business Strategies: While Zest for Success is motivational, it also offers plenty of practical advice. Berry covers essential topics such as business planning, market research, and financial management. She provides clear, actionable steps for setting up a business, from identifying a viable business idea to creating a solid marketing plan. Her approach is straightforward, making it accessible for new entrepreneurs who may be overwhelmed by the complexities of starting a business.
Building a Sustainable Business: Sustainability is another central theme of the book. Berry stresses the importance of creating a business model that can thrive in the long term, rather than just focusing on short-term profits. She encourages entrepreneurs to build strong customer relationships, invest in their brand, and create systems that allow the business to grow without overwhelming its founders. This focus on sustainability ensures that businesses can survive the inevitable ups and downs of the entrepreneurial journey.
Overcoming Fear and Self-Doubt: Berry addresses the psychological barriers that often hold aspiring entrepreneurs back, such as fear of failure and self-doubt. She provides strategies for overcoming these mental hurdles and emphasizes the importance of taking calculated risks. Through personal stories and examples from successful entrepreneurs, Berry demonstrates that fear is a natural part of the process and can be managed with the right mindset.
Writing Style
Victoria Berry’s writing is engaging, relatable, and easy to digest. She uses a conversational tone that feels like a supportive mentor guiding readers through the challenges of entrepreneurship. Berry’s blend of motivational language and practical advice makes the book both inspiring and actionable.
The book is structured in a way that allows readers to easily follow along, with each chapter building logically on the last. Berry includes plenty of real-world examples, case studies, and personal anecdotes that make the concepts come to life. This storytelling approach helps readers see how the principles she discusses can be applied in their own businesses.
Overall Assessment
Zest for Success is an excellent resource for new and aspiring entrepreneurs looking for a mix of inspiration and practical guidance. Berry’s emphasis on mindset, passion, and resilience makes the book particularly valuable for those who are just starting out and may be feeling uncertain about their entrepreneurial journey. Her straightforward advice on business planning, customer acquisition, and financial management provides the foundation new entrepreneurs need to get their ventures off the ground.
One of the strengths of the book is its holistic approach to entrepreneurship. Berry not only covers the practical aspects of starting a business but also dives into the psychological and emotional challenges that entrepreneurs face. By addressing both the tactical and mental sides of entrepreneurship, Zest for Success offers a well-rounded roadmap for success.
A potential critique is that the book may feel a bit basic for more experienced entrepreneurs who are already familiar with the fundamentals of business. However, for those who are just getting started or need a confidence boost, Berry’s approachable writing style and positive tone make the book an inspiring read.

Zest for Success by Victoria Berry is best suited for the following stages of business:
1. Startup Stage:
Why: The book is particularly valuable for individuals who are in the early stages of starting a business or are thinking about launching their first venture. Berry provides a roadmap for taking a business idea and turning it into reality, with practical advice on planning, market research, and setting up foundational business processes. Her emphasis on overcoming fear, building confidence, and aligning passion with business goals is essential for entrepreneurs who are new to the challenges of business ownership.
Benefit: It helps aspiring entrepreneurs focus on building a strong foundation by offering step-by-step guidance on everything from idea generation to building customer relationships. The motivational aspect of the book helps entrepreneurs push through initial fears and uncertainties.
2. Early Growth Stage:
Why: For businesses that have launched but are still in the early growth phase, Zest for Success provides valuable insights on how to refine operations, build sustainability, and maintain focus on long-term goals. Berry’s advice on creating systems, managing finances, and building customer loyalty is critical as businesses try to grow beyond the initial launch phase.
Benefit: Entrepreneurs in this stage can benefit from Berry’s strategies on building a sustainable business model that can scale over time. The book also helps in maintaining resilience and a positive mindset as they navigate the complexities of business growth.
3. Businesses in Need of Refocus:
Why: The book is also useful for business owners who may feel stuck or overwhelmed and need to refocus their energy and resources. Berry’s emphasis on passion and purpose can help business owners re-evaluate their direction, prune distractions, and realign their business with their core strengths and goals.
Benefit: For businesses that may have lost focus or need a fresh injection of energy and purpose, the book provides motivational guidance and practical steps for getting back on track and fostering renewed enthusiasm for growth.
Not Ideal for Established Businesses or Advanced Entrepreneurs:
Why: More experienced entrepreneurs and well-established businesses may find Zest for Success to be too focused on the basics. For those already running larger or more complex operations, the book’s emphasis on foundational business strategies and mindset might not provide the depth they need for advanced scaling or strategic decision-making.
Benefit: These entrepreneurs might need more specialized or advanced business resources that focus on scaling, market expansion, or deeper financial strategy.
Conclusion:
Zest for Success is best suited for aspiring entrepreneurs, new business owners in the startup phase, and those in the early growth stage. It provides both motivational and practical tools to build and sustain a business, focusing on mindset, passion, and core business principles. The book is less relevant for more established or advanced businesses but is an excellent guide for those starting their entrepreneurial journey.
